A second season of Mahou Shoujo ni Akogarete has been officially announced! The announcement was made at the Mahoako SM (Sugoku Moriagatta yo) Dai Kansha-sai event in October 2024, and the project is currently in production. As of now, no specific release date has been set, but the second season is one of the most anticipated upcoming anime releases.

In doing so, the series critiques the very concept of the “pure heroine.” The magical girls—Magia Azul, Rosado, and Sulfur—are initially presented as paragons of virtue. Yet, as Utena systematically defeats and tortures them, they begin to crack. Azul develops a humiliation kink. Sulfur, the hot-headed one, learns to crave the pain of battle. The narrative cleverly reveals that their heroism was never altruistic; it was an addiction to a specific form of conflict. Utena does not corrupt them; she awakens the latent desires that the “system” of magical girls suppressed. The show posits that the constant cycle of fighting, losing, and winning creates a co-dependent, almost erotic relationship between hero and villain. Without a villain to fight, the hero has no purpose. Utena, by refusing to be a conventional threat, exposes the heroines’ need for her.

In conclusion, Mahou Shoujo ni Akogarete is a brilliant, obscene, and deeply affectionate essay on the magical girl genre. It uses the language of BDSM and horror comedy to ask an uncomfortable question: What if the magical girl’s greatest fan isn’t a future hero, but a future villain who loves them too much ? By answering that question with gleeful depravity, the series does not destroy the magical girl ideal. Instead, it invites us to look beyond the sparkles and speeches, acknowledging that behind every cry of “In the name of the moon!” lies a more primal, messy, and utterly human desire to be seen, to be broken, and to be desired in return. The story follows , a middle-school girl who is a massive fan of the "Tres Magia" magical girls. Her life takes a sudden turn when a dark mascot named Venalita tricks her into becoming a villain rather than a hero.

"Mahou Shoujo ni Akogarete" is a Japanese web manga series written and illustrated by Akihiro Ononaka. Serialization began on Takeshobo's Manga Life STORIA Dash website in March 2019. It quickly garnered attention for its unique and subversive take on the beloved magical girl genre, blending it with unexpected elements of slapstick comedy and risqué humor.
